Default SkyShark Edge 540

I am almost finished with the Edge. Need to mount wheel pants, tail wheel, canopy and break engine in. Overall it is a great plane and easy to build. I am going with a Klett tailwheel and mounted the Saito 100 inverted. These are the only thing I did different. Attached are photos of almost finished plane and I will have a video in a week or so.
